The Ohio Crossover Athletics Most Valuable Player Award is given to a player who exemplifies excellence on both ends of the floor and is indispensable to the team's overall success.  This player has talent, intelligence, work ethic, and leads by example on and off the court.  I am proud to announce that the winner of the 2013 11th Grade Boys Most Valuable Player Award is Tyler Flanigan from Glen Este High School.

 

Tyler was our most consistent all-around player this season. He led the team in scoring, was second on the team in assists and steals, and was third on the team in rebounding. Tyler can score from inside and outside. Whether it was hitting one of his team leading 41 three-pointers, driving from the wing, posting up, or grabbing an offensive rebound and putting it back in, Tyler always found a way to help his team on the offensive end. He is also a very versatile defender who can guard multiple positions and the rest of the team fed off of his intensity. Tyler made everyone around him better and his leadership and communication with teammates was invaluable. He was always willing to sacrifice his body to take a charge, dive for a loose ball, jump to save a bad pass, or defend a bigger player. His all-around game was on display against the Northside Spartans Premier from Michigan at the Spiece Memorial Day Madness Tournament. He was 8 for 13 from the field, 1 for 3 from the three-point line, 7 for 9 from the free throw line, and had 6 rebounds, 2 assists, and 3 steals to lead the team to a big win. Tyler is a coach's dream. He's a smart, talented player who listens, looks you in the eye, and always gives great effort. He always represented our program in a first class manner on and off the court. I enjoyed coaching Tyler this season and expect him to have a fantastic Senior season at Glen Este High School and to have the opportunity to continue his career on the next level.
